Abstract

The utility model relates to a filter with a telescopic filter cartridge for sewage treatment, which comprises a water inlet pipeline (1), an inner water inlet pipeline (15), a shell (6) and the filter cartridge, wherein a supporting back seat (16) is connected with the inner side of the shell (6), and a flange pipe (19) is connected with the outer side of the shell (6). The filter with the telescopic filter cartridge for sewage treatment is characterized in that: the filter cartridge comprises an external filter cartridge (21) and an internal filter cartridge (24) which are connected in a nesting way, and the internal filter cartridge (21) axially extends and retracts along the internal filter cartridge (24). In the filter with the telescopic filter cartridge for sewage treatment, the effective length of the filter cartridge is effectively shortened, thus the length aspect of the whole filter cartridge is changed, and the filter with the telescopic filter cartridge is suitable for a filter system in a confined space. Under the premise of ensuring that the filter effect is unaffected, the situation that the dependence of the replacement and cleaning operation of the filter cartridge of the filter on the space is reduced in actual use is ensured, so that the whole filter cartridge is fully cleaned, the working strength of maintenance staff is reduced, the maintenance time is shortened, and the working efficiency and maintenance benefit are improved.

Background technology
Can often produce the sewage that further to handle in a large number in the enterprise production process, especially no longer may untreated sewage directly be discharged as manufacturing enterprises such as iron and steel enterprises.
In the process of handling these sewage; filter is indispensable a kind of device on the conveyance conduit; filter is installed in the entrance point of pressure-reducing valve, relief valve, water level valve or miscellaneous equipment usually, is used for eliminating the impurity in the medium, with the normal use of protection valve and equipment.After entering the filter cylinder that is equipped with the certain specification filter screen when fluid, its impurity is blocked, and the filtrate of cleaning is then discharged by strainer screen.Therefore, Filter cartridge is to need the often parts of cleaning at ordinary times, generally gets final product reloading after the filter cylinder taking-up cleaning treatment.
At present, in the actual production of enterprise, using filter miscellaneous, have big have little, have precision high have precision low, but these filters all have a kind of common characteristic: their filter cylinder all is non-telescoping.There is following defective in the non-telescoping formula filter of this filter cylinder: (1) is to because of being subjected to the filter of device space restriction place, just can't extract filter cylinder out completely, carry out fully effectively cleaning, can only the be passive part of taking out be cleaned according to on-site actual situations, and the part of failing to take out, filter cylinder just can't be cleaned timely and effectively, and the dirt on filter cylinder surface will be tied more and more, finally influences the filter effect of filter.When (2) changing filter cylinder,, must sever the outlet conduit of filter, so not only increase maintainer's working strength, and increased the overhaul of the equipments time owing to filter cylinder can't be extracted out.
Present domestic following several the relevant patents that mainly contain.
Application number/patent No.: 200420093896 patent names: flexible rotation, the filter cylinder telescoping mechanism of holding concurrently of a kind of filter of hydraulic filter.This patent provides a kind of mechanism that directly can be enclosed within the also adjustable filter cylinder elongation that just can extend within the specific limits on the plain filter filter cylinder outward, realizes the elongation of filter cylinder by hydraulic pressure.The characteristics of this patent are that filter cylinder length can often adjust and rotatable, are mainly used in the filtration in the mailbox, and use hydraulic-driven, and patent structure complexity, operation are various, are not suitable for the filtration system of sewage disposal.
Application number/patent No.: 91224107 patent names: the telescopic millipore filter of a kind of vacuum chamber.This patent is a kind of millipore filter, what its vacuum cylindrical shell adopted is the extension type structure, fit constitutes by the upper bush that has loam cake and inside and outside having the lower sleeve of base, upper and lower sleeve can endwisely slip along it mutually, it makes vacuum cylinder can do double-filtration and series connection use by the improvement to the vacuum cylinder body structure.This patent mainly is applicable to the investigation and analysis of water quality such as ocean, rivers, lake, belongs to the film separation field, adopts membrane filtration, as is applied to the effluent treatment and filtering system, will influence filter effect, makes the filtration cost too high.
The utility model content
Can not extract out fully in order to solve in the site examining and repairing operation filter cylinder, it is not thorough to influence Filter cartridge surface dirt removal, cause the problem of filter poor filtration effect, the purpose of this utility model is to provide a kind of filter cylinder extension type filter, make that whole filter cylinder is fully cleaned in maintenance process, guarantee filter effect, reduce maintainer's working strength, shorten the repair time, increase work efficiency and overhaul benefit.
The technical solution of the utility model is, a kind of filter cylinder extension type filter that is used for sewage disposal, comprise inlet channel, interior inlet channel, shell and filter cylinder, supporting back seat is connected with shell is inboard, flanged pipe is connected with the shell outside, it is characterized in that described filter cylinder comprises outer filter cylinder and interior filter cylinder, described outer filter cylinder is connected with interior filter cylinder fit, and interior filter cylinder is along outer filter cylinder axial stretching.
Outer filter cylinder embeds in the annular groove that supports back seat near interior inlet channel one side, support back seat and shell inboard by being welded to connect, the flanged pipe and the shell outside are by being welded to connect, interior filter cylinder is fastening by fastening bolt near outlet conduit one side, the telescopic illiteracy plate that is used to seal inserts flanged pipe, interior filter cylinder is flexible to be positioned by dog screw behind desired location, between outer filter cylinder and the dog screw sealing ring is arranged, back-up ring is used to filter cylinder to provide support, it is fastening that fastening bolt utilizes bolt that filter cylinder is carried out, and telescopic illiteracy plate has two effects, and one provides the power of axially fastening, second effect is the sealing that is used for flanged pipe, prevents that liquid flows out in the filter.
The utility model adopts the extension type filter cylinder to stretch by the mutual of inside and outside filter cylinder, effectively dwindles the filter cylinder effective length, thereby realizes the change of filter cylinder entire length aspect, is applicable to the restricted clearance filter system, belongs to the single-stage filtration system.Realization filter cylinder effective length is dwindled, and is convenient to the purpose of using under the situation of restricted clearance.Guaranteeing under the impregnable prerequisite of filter effect, guarantee to accomplish to reduce of the dependence of the replacing washing and cleaning operation of Filter cartridge in actual use, make that whole filter cylinder is fully cleaned, reduce maintainer's working strength the space, shorten the repair time, increase work efficiency and overhaul benefit.

The specific embodiment
Below in conjunction with accompanying drawing the specific embodiment of the present utility model is described in further detail.
The utility model is by inlet channel 1, interior inlet channel 15, outer filter cylinder 21, interior filter cylinder 24 connects successively, outer filter cylinder 21 embeds in the circular groove that supports back seat 16 near interior inlet channel 15 1 sides, described support back seat 16 and shell 6 inboards are welded to connect, filter cylinder 24 is fastening by fastening bolt 18 near outlet conduit 13 1 sides in described, flanged pipe 19 is welded in shell 6 outsides, telescopic illiteracy plate 20 inserts flanged pipe 19, described outer filter cylinder 21 is connected with interior filter cylinder 24 fits, interior filter cylinder 24 is along outer filter cylinder 21 transversal stretchings, interior filter cylinder 24 stretches and positions by dog screw 23 behind desired location, between outer filter cylinder 21 and the dog screw 23 sealing ring 22 is arranged.
Back-up ring 17 is used to filter cylinder to provide support, and it is fastening that fastening bolt 18 utilizes bolt that filter cylinder is carried out, and telescopic illiteracy plate 20 has two effects, and one provides the power of axially fastening, and second effect is the sealing that is used for flanged pipe 19, prevents that liquid flows out in the filter.
Sewage is flowed into by flange 2 through shell 6 by inlet channel 1, inlet channel 15 enters into outer filter cylinder 21 and interior filter cylinder 24 inside in flowing through, after sewage enters the outer filter cylinder 21 that is equipped with the certain specification filter screen and interior filter cylinder 24 and fully filters, its impurity is blocked, the filtrate of cleaning then discharges from inside and outside filter cylinder 21 and interior filter cylinder 24 outer surfaces, through flange 14, by outlet conduit 13 to control valve 11, enter the ground water regime pipe network by pipeline through ground 8 at last, simultaneously, whole filter bottom is equipped with sewage draining exit 5 and is used for periodical blowdown, finally finishes the water treatment overall process.
In the process of filter cylinder 21 and interior filter cylinder 24, telescopic illiteracy plate 20 can be taken off outside cleaning, the fastening bolt 18 of outwarding winding with outer filter cylinder 21 and interior filter cylinder 24 whole extractions out, takes out dog screw 23 then and interior filter cylinder 24 and outer filter cylinder 21 can be decomposed, and cleans respectively.
The utility model does not influence original filter effect in actual practical process, eliminated because filter can not taken out, and it is clear not thorough to influence Filter cartridge surface dirt, causes the problem of filter poor filtration effect.The maintainer can take out telescopic filter cylinder now comparatively easily, carries out careful cleaning, and it is also extremely convenient to install.Can not extract the filter cylinder aspect with being used in for a long time again, shorten the repair time, reduce the labour intensity of work, guarantee filter effect simultaneously.
